
MUMBAI: The legendary Indian crime drama CID has officially returned to the small screen, and fans across the nation couldn’t be more thrilled.
With its gripping investigations, iconic characters, and unforgettable catchphrases, the show has carved out a permanent place in Indian television history. Now, as the series marks its much-anticipated revival, it does so with a jaw-dropping twist that has left viewers on the edge of their seats.
In a recent string of episodes, audiences were left stunned when Dr Salunkhe — CID’s brilliant and sharp-tongued forensic expert was shockingly accused of betrayal and sent to prison.
The revelation rocked the core of the beloved team, particularly because of the close bond shared between Salunkhe and ACP Pradyuman.

However, the narrative took a dramatic turn in the latest episode. It was finally unveiled that the Dr Salunkhe who appeared during ACP’s alleged death was, in fact, an imposter.
In a brilliant masterstroke, ACP Pradyuman had always harboured doubts, convinced that the real Dr Salunkhe could never betray the team he had loyally served for years.
The truth surfaced in a high-octane sequence where the real Salunkhe was discovered alive, imprisoned in secrecy.
Meanwhile, the impostor — planted by the notorious Barbosa’s gang — met a swift and fatal end at the hands of Barbosa’s own men.
The revelation not only cleared Dr Salunkhe’s name but also brought a wave of emotion as he was warmly welcomed back into the CID fold.
ACP Pradyuman’s expression of relief and pride upon reuniting with his long-time colleague reminded viewers of the deep camaraderie that has always defined the team.
